What Are Healing Stones?

Definition and Origins

Healing stones (also called crystals, gemstones, or healing crystals) are naturally occurring minerals and rocks used for physical, emotional, and spiritual well-being. The practice of using stones for healing dates back thousands of years across virtually every culture.

Historical use:
- Ancient Egypt: Lapis lazuli, turquoise, carnelian in amulets and burial rituals
- Traditional Chinese Medicine: Jade for kidney health, specific stones for organ systems
- Ayurvedic medicine (India): Gemstone therapy based on planetary influences
- Native American: Turquoise, obsidian, clear quartz in ceremony and healing
- Greek and Roman: Amethyst to prevent intoxication, hematite for warriors' strength

Modern resurgence:
After declining with rise of modern medicine, crystal healing resurged in 1970s New Age movement. Now experiencing massive mainstream adoption—no longer "alternative" but integrated into wellness culture.

How Healing Stones Are Believed to Work

Energy theory (metaphysical view):
Practitioners believe crystals have stable vibrational frequencies that interact with human energy field (aura). When placed on or near body, stones' vibrations influence your energy, promoting balance and healing.

Piezoelectric effect (scientific property):
Some crystals (quartz, tourmaline) generate electric charge under pressure—used in watches, electronics. This measurable property lends credibility to idea of crystals affecting energy, though leap to "healing" isn't scientifically proven.

Placebo and intention (psychological mechanism):
Most scientists attribute crystal healing to placebo effect—but that doesn't mean it doesn't work. Placebo effect is real effect. Believing stone helps reduces stress, and reduced stress improves health. Intention-setting with physical object (crystal) is powerful psychological tool.

Mindfulness anchor (practical function):
Holding crystal during meditation, stress, decision-making creates moment of pause. That pause—that breath before reacting—is where healing happens. Stone is reminder, not medicine.

Truth: We don't fully understand how healing stones work. Combination of placebo, intention, mineral properties, and ritual psychology likely all play roles. But billions of people across thousands of years have found them helpful—that's data worth respecting, even without complete scientific explanation.

Cleansing and Charging Healing Stones

Why Cleanse?

Stones absorb energy during use—from you, environment, others who touch them. Regular cleansing removes accumulated energy, restoring stone to neutral state.

Cleansing Methods

Running water (simplest):
- Hold under cool tap 1-2 minutes
- Visualize stuck energy washing away
- Safe for most stones
- Avoid: selenite, halite, calcite (water-soluble)

Moonlight (gentlest):
- Leave outside or on windowsill overnight
- Full moon most powerful
- Safe for all stones
- Cleanses and charges simultaneously

Sunlight:
- 2-4 hours in sun
- Powerful charge
- Avoid: amethyst, rose quartz, citrine (can fade)
- Good for: clear quartz, carnelian, red stones

Are healing stones safe?

Generally yes, with precautions: Physical safety: Don't ingest (crystal elixirs require specific safe methods), keep away from children/pets (choking hazard), avoid toxic stones (malachite, cinnabar release harmful substances when wet). Emotional safety: Some stones (moldavite, malachite) trigger intense emotional releases—use with therapist support if dealing with trauma. Medical safety: NEVER replace medical treatment with crystals. Use as complementary tool alongside, not instead of, professional healthcare. Anyone with serious physical/mental condition should always consult doctor.
